Larue, TX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ent a home in Larue?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Larue 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,417 | $725 | $2,300 |
Larue 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,845 | $1,250 | $3,500 |
Larue 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,248 | $1,650 | $3,750 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Larue
What type of rentals are currently available in Larue?
There are currently 36 Apartments for Rent in Larue, TX with pricing that ranges from $377 to $4,754. There are also 32 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Larue ranging from $450 to $3,750.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Larue?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Larue ranges from $450 to $3,750 with an average monthly rent of $1,490.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Larue?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Larue range from $532 to $2,370,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,250 to $3,500.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,650 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$591.
